Embracing the Artistic Industrial Style
The artistic industrial style is characterized by raw textures and utilitarian features, which creates a unique and captivating atmosphere. One of the key elements of this style is the use of exposed beams, which can be made of steel, wood, or other materials. Exposed beams can add a surprising rustic charm and architectural intrigue to any space, seamlessly blending old-world allure with contemporary design.

7 Creative Ways to Incorporate Exposed Beams into Your Design
- 1. Exposed Ceiling Beams: Creating a dramatic and stylish ceiling with exposed beams can add a touch of raw elegance to any space.
- 2. Combination of Steel and Wood Beams: Combining raw steel supports with reclaimed wood beams can create an authentic industrial aesthetic.
- 3. Limewash Paint for Beams: Using limewash paint on beams can rejuvenate them while keeping the character and rustic charm intact.
- 4. Exposed Brick Walls and Steel Beams: Exposed brick walls paired with steel beams can create a rugged and industrial look.
- 5. Creative Use of Beams as Decor: Exposed beams can be used as a natural decorative element, adding a touch of rustic charm to any space.
- 6. Industrial Hardware and Exposed Beams: Industrial-inspired hardware paired with exposed beams can create a subtle utilitarian character.
- 7. Colorful Accents on Beams: Adding colorful accents to exposed beams can break up the neutral color palette and add a touch of personality to a room.
